About Quadral

Quadral emerged from Hanover, Germany in 1972 as the consumer audio division of the All Group, initially operating under the name all-akustik before adopting the Quadral brand in the late 1970s. The company's international breakthrough came with the introduction of the TITAN loudspeaker in 1981, establishing Quadral as a serious contender in premium audio. Today, Quadral operates under the ownership of Loxone, acquired in 2020, which has positioned the brand at the intersection of high-fidelity audio and intelligent building automation.

Quadral has built its reputation primarily as a loudspeaker manufacturer, with particular acclaim for its ribbon tweeters and flagship Aurum series. The company's engineering approach emphasizes clarity, tonal balance, and sophisticated acoustic design—hallmarks that quickly elevated the brand to the upper echelon of the hi-fi world upon its launch. Production of key components, including the renowned Aurum ribbon tweeters, remains based in Hanover, underscoring the brand's commitment to German manufacturing standards.

Quadral occupies the high-end to upper-midrange segment of the consumer audio market, positioning itself alongside other respected German speaker specialists. The brand appeals to discerning listeners who prioritize acoustic performance and engineering heritage over mass-market accessibility. With over five decades of experience and a track record of consistent quality, Quadral maintains credibility among serious audiophiles and collectors, though it remains less widely recognized than some larger international competitors.
